[ ] Off-site run — recalled chargers. Confirm the pallet of recalled Voltbryn chargers is shrink-wrapped, tagged with the red recall stickers, and staged in Bay 4 before the 14:00 pickup. Count should match the recall manifest: 212 units, no substitutions. Do not mix with outbound retail stock. Forklift access to Bay 4 is blocked until the morning shift clears the aisle, so stage by 11:00 at the latest. Relay the line below to the courier at hand-over.

dispatch memo: the eliok quenok courier leaves the sorael aldath belion tammir casix gileth queniel jorath ledger at gate 9299 under passcode 897989

## Releases

Stormfan (our weather-alert fan-out service) ships on a two-week cadence, usually Thursdays so nobody's paging over a weekend. Cut a release branch, run the fan-out soak test against the synthetic alert feed, and make sure delivery latency stays under the usual threshold. Once that's green, build the container and sign it — the cluster won't pull unsigned images, full stop. When you get to the signing step, use the key below.

deploy key for hawef-yadup: bky19_kVT4YunTZZSTyhFQQoK

Subject: Squatwatch cut-over done

Hey — quick recap before you dive in. We switched the typo-squatting scanner, Squatwatch, over to the new registry feed last night. Old crawler is off, alerts now flow through the triage queue. A few false positives are expected this week, so don't panic. The scanner is currently running with the config below.

service settings:
novath:
  pin: 1396
  tenant: pelys
  seal: seal_ccc035e1
  metrics_host: metrics.novath.qorvelworks.test
  standby_team: fraeth
  escalation: drueth-zorok
  nonce: 61d508

**Q: How do I get into the Veltrana pop-up office at the Marrowfield Trade Fair?** During the fair, Veltrana operates a temporary office behind Hall C, near the blue service corridor. New starters should arrive at least fifteen minutes early, sign the visitor ledger at the kiosk, and confirm their name with the duty coordinator. Once verified, enter the pop-up through the keypad door using the code below.

turnstile pass: bdg-CY-5